Geometric Model by A. Harry Wheeler, Eight Octahedra Inscriptible in an Octahedron or in a Cube

- Description
- This tan cut and folded paper model reprewsents the intersection of eight regular octahedra. It can be inscribed in either a cube and a regular octahedron. A tag on the model reads: 150. Another mark reads: Eight octahedra (/) Inscriptible in an (/) Octahedron (/) or in (/) a cube July 23, 1931 (/) No. (/) 150.
